Brands and retailers like these, are damaging the cause as they confuse and create mistrust in consumers.<\/p><h3>The Definition:<\/h3><p>According to the Cambridge Dictionary, <a href=\"https:\/\/dictionary.cambridge.org\/dictionary\/english\/sustainability\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">SUSTAINABILITY<\/a> is: the\u00a0quality\u00a0of\u00a0causing\u00a0little or no\u00a0damage\u00a0to the\u00a0environment\u00a0and\u00a0therefore\u00a0able\u00a0to\u00a0continue\u00a0for a\u00a0long time.<\/p><p>With this in mind, I\u2019d like to point out that it is not possible at this time to be 100% sustainable. Any brand that claims that it is, either does not understand sustainability or is GREENWASHING you.<\/p><h3>So how do we define Sustainable Fashion?<\/h3><p>By definition alone, the whole garment and manufacturing process would need to cause little or no damage to the environment. Therefore, the sustainability of each element of a product should be taken into account and outweigh the negative impact on the environment.<\/p><p>For example: A t-shirt made from organic cotton sounds fantastic, but can NOT be classed as sustainable if:<\/p><ul><li><p>the organic cotton is not certified.<\/p><\/li><li><p>toxic dyes are used,<\/p><\/li><li><p>glitter printing is used. (unless they're using eco glitter)<\/p><\/li><li><p>plastisol inks are used.<\/p><\/li><li><p>it is produced in a factory powered by fossil fuels,<\/p><\/li><li><p>it is packed in plastic,<\/p><\/li><li><p>it is not recyclable or circular.<\/p><\/li><\/ul><p>The most you could say is that this product is using sustainable materials*. The t-shirt itself is not sustainable, as the damage caused to the environment outweighs the \u2018organic status\u2019 of the cotton.<\/p><p>* Organic cotton alone is not actually sustainable, in fact no raw material is\u2026 but that is a whole other blog post, which I will be writing in the future.<\/p><h2>What to look out for:<\/h2><p>A brand that is truly sustainable, will always be able to tell you the journey of their product from seed to shop. They will be completely transparent, and it will be well documented on their website. If it isn\u2019t... then ask questions**.
